1
Q

What is the Rule of Law?

A

Everyone must follow the law, leaders must obey the law, govt must obey the law, no-one is above the law.

2
Q

What are two rights in the Declaration of Independence?

A

Life, liberty and the pursuit of happiness.

3
Q

What do we call the first ten amendments to the constitution?

A

The Bill of Rights

4
Q

What is the economic system in the US?

A

Market economy, capitalist economy

5
Q

What is freedom of religion?

A

The freedom to practice a religion or not practice a religion.

6
Q

The idea of self-government is in the first three words of the constitution. What are these words?

A

We the people.

7
Q

What does the constitution do?

A

Sets up with he govt, defines the govt, protects basic rights of Americans.

8
Q

What did the Declaration of Independence do?

A

Announced our independence from Great Britain
Declared our independence from Great Britain
Said that the US was free of Great Britain

9
Q

What is an amendment?

A

A change or addition to the constitution.

10
Q

How many amendments does the constitution have?

A

27

11
Q

What is one right o freedom from the first amendment?

A

Freedom of speech, religion, assembly, freedom of the press or freedom to petition the govt.

12
Q

What is the supreme law of the land?

A

The Constitution
